Dental Bonding: Before and After

Dental bonding can be done as a final restoration, or to stop decay and protect the tooth until a crown can be done. “Bonding” is actually the process of attaching a substance to the tooth, so crowns and veneers are bonded too. Learn more with Dalton Dental.

Pictures of Before and After Dental Bonding

In the following examples, we are using bonding to mean restorations that are done directly in the mouth without the need to send them to a lab, or sit for a second appointment.
